Lurline's Enchantment of Oz

  1. Explicit Relative Order

    Queen Lurline Enchants Oz

    While passing over isolated Oz, Queen Lurline's fairy band enchants the country and makes it a Fairyland.

    The Tin Woodsman of Oz · Ch. 12 · ¶ 3

  2. Explicit Relative Order

    Lurline Leaves a Fairy to Rule Oz

    Queen Lurline leaves one of her own fairies to rule the newly enchanted Land of Oz; later Baum identifies Ozma with Lurline's fairy band.

    The Tin Woodsman of Oz · Ch. 12 · ¶ 3

  3. Explicit Relative Order

    Deathlessness Begins in Enchanted Oz

    From the moment Oz becomes a Fairyland, its inhabitants cease to die naturally or age in the ordinary way, though total destruction remains possible.

    The Tin Woodsman of Oz · Ch. 12 · ¶ 4

Older Ozian Local History

  1. Retrospectively Described

    Gayelette Prepares to Marry Quelala

    In an earlier period, the sorceress-princess Gayelette raises Quelala and prepares to marry him.

    The Wonderful Wizard of Oz · Ch. 14 · ¶ 34

  2. Retrospectively Described

    Winged Monkeys Drop Quelala into the River

    The King of the Winged Monkeys and his band seize Quelala before his wedding and drop him into a river as a joke.

    The Wonderful Wizard of Oz · Ch. 14 · ¶ 35

  3. Retrospectively Described

    Gayelette Binds the Winged Monkeys to the Golden Cap

    Gayelette spares the Winged Monkeys on condition that they perform three commands for each owner of the Golden Cap, which had been made as a wedding gift for Quelala.

    The Wonderful Wizard of Oz · Ch. 14 · ¶ 37

History of Ev

  1. Relative Placement Only

    Smith & Tinker Manufacture Tik-Tok

    Tik-Tok is manufactured at Smith & Tinker's works in Evna, Land of Ev.

    Ozma of Oz · Ch. 4 · ¶ 28

  2. Retrospectively Described

    King Evoldo Sells His Family to the Nome King

    King Evoldo sells his wife and ten children to the Nome King in exchange for a long life.

    Ozma of Oz · Ch. 9 · ¶ 6

  3. Retrospectively Described

    Evoldo Jumps into the Sea

    After selling his family for long life, Evoldo destroys that life by jumping into the sea.

    Ozma of Oz · Ch. 9 · ¶ 6
